Hymn 108: I To the hills will lift mine eyes. / Worship / By Peter Honfor Verse 1 I To the hills will lift mine eyes. From whence doth come mine aid: My safety cometh from the Lord, Who heav’n and earth hath made. Verse 2 Thy foot He’ll not let slide, nor will He slumber that keeps: Behold He that keeps Israel, He slumbers not, nor sleeps. Verse 3 The Lord thee keeps, the Lord thy shade On thy right hand doth stay; The moon by night thee shall not smite, Nor yet the sun by day.
